"Super-simple, low-calorie, great-tasting meal ideas aren't easy to come by. 300 Under 300 will offer up so many guilt-free breakfast, lunch and dinner dishes, it'll make your head spin! It's meal-mania, HG style! This book features three hundred satisfying and delicious recipes for full on meals, snazzy sides and satisfying snacks that contain less than 300 calories. In addition to traditional Hungry girl recipes, this book will serve up a slew of soon-to-be famous HG triplets: three-ingredient combos that take easy to a whole new level! Included will be... Chicken Carbonara a la Hungry Girl, Kickin' Buttermilk, Faux-Fried Chicken, Jumpin' Jack Chicken with Mashies Platter, Twice-as-Nice Guapo Taco, Crispy-licious Faux-Fried Onion, Frenzy Crock-Pot , Cinna-Apples 'n Oats, Cheesy Pigs in Bacon, Blankies Early-Riser, Pigs in a Blanket Breakfast Scramble, Pizza Pie, Outside-In Turkey Tamale Pie, Purple Pizza Eaters, The Crab Rangoonies, Pizza-bellas ...and more!"--
